Aquamarine Stone in Pakistan: Costs and Value
The allure of crystals is undeniable, and Pakistan holds a surprising, yet significant, place in the global aquamarine market. While not as prolific as Brazil or Madagascar, Pakistan's aquamarine deposits, primarily found in the Khyber Pakhtunkhwa province, produce stones with a distinct character – often showcasing aquamarine stone benefits a beautiful, delicate azure hue. The value of Pakistani aquamarine varies wildly, dependent on several factors. Larger, clearer stones with exceptional color command significantly higher rates. Generally, rough aquamarine can be acquired for anywhere between $5 to $30 per carat, but this base cost is just the beginning. Lapidaries (stone cutters) in Pakistan, and abroad, must then skillfully cut and polish the mineral, a process that adds substantially to the final retail expense. Factors like clarity, cut quality, and carat weight all play vital roles; a flawless, exceptionally large stone can easily fetch hundreds, even thousands, of dollars per carat. The scene for Pakistani aquamarine is largely driven by international demand, with buyers from Europe and North America frequently sourcing these unique crystals for jewelry and collectors.

Aquamarine Stone in Pakistan: Factors Affecting Price
The cost of aquamarine gems sourced from Pakistan is a fascinating area, influenced by a confluence of elements. Primarily, the shade plays a significant influence; deeper, more intense blue-green shades generally command higher prices than paler specimens. Furthermore, the purity dramatically affects the market worth; stones with fewer inclusions or blemishes are naturally more preferred. The dimension is another critical factor - larger, well-formed crystals are much rarer and therefore attract premium values. The source within Pakistan's Khyber Pakhtunkhwa province also contributes; certain mines are known for producing higher quality aquamarine, subsequently impacting costs. Finally, the style – whether it's a standard brilliant cut or a more elaborate, custom design – adds to the overall cost, alongside the demand from both local and international markets.
